Output 81b4bd383b1358878eaa07c9dc5aae1c922efecfb8c98caf4deac00dac29b44e:26

value
12862500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 13e63351bb68220660adf6989c58eb4ced07a00b OP_EQUALVERIFY OP_CHECKSIG
address
12pDcFhwzubzqDrVADYDgHs3uzBXes2ECr
transaction
81b4bd383b1358878eaa07c9dc5aae1c922efecfb8c98caf4deac00dac29b44e
spent
true